PolarDB 5.6升级到8.0后CPU占用率增高的原因
1. 架构变化
PolarDB从5.6版本升级到8.0版本,其底层架构发生了显著的变化,8.0版本的架构更加复杂,需要更多的CPU资源来处理相同的任务。
版本 | 架构复杂度 | CPU需求 |
5.6 | 低 | 低 |
8.0 | 高 | 高 |
2. 功能增加
PolarDB 8.0版本增加了许多新的功能和特性,如更好的性能优化、更强的安全性等,这些新功能的运行需要消耗更多的CPU资源。
版本 | 功能数量 | CPU需求 |
5.6 | 少 | 低 |
8.0 | 多 | 高 |
3. 查询优化
PolarDB 8.0版本对查询进行了更深度的优化,使得查询效率更高,这种优化需要更多的CPU资源来实现。
版本 | 查询优化程度 | CPU需求 |
5.6 | 低 | 低 |
8.0 | 高 | 高 |
4. 并发处理
PolarDB 8.0版本在并发处理方面也有所提升,可以同时处理更多的请求,这同样需要更多的CPU资源。
版本 | 并发处理能力 | CPU需求 |
5.6 | 低 | 低 |
8.0 | 高 | 高 |
5. 内存管理
PolarDB 8.0版本在内存管理方面也进行了优化,使得内存使用更加高效,这种优化也需要消耗更多的CPU资源。
版本 | 内存管理效率 | CPU需求 |
5.6 | 低 | 低 |
8.0 | 高 | 高 |
PolarDB从5.6版本升级到8.0版本后,由于架构变化、功能增加、查询优化、并发处理和内存管理等方面的改进,导致其CPU占用率增高。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/667821.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复